Size: a a a

Язык программирования Julia / Julia programming language

2020 September 16

АО

Андрей Оськин... in Язык программирования Julia / Julia programming language
Другими словами, следующие две команды эквивалентны

Cmd(["ls"])

`ls`

Вторая является синтаксическим сахаром для первой
источник

АО

Андрей Оськин... in Язык программирования Julia / Julia programming language
Первая команда - это обычный конструктор для типа Cmd
источник

АО

Андрей Оськин... in Язык программирования Julia / Julia programming language
Определяется в base/cmd.jl

struct Cmd <: AbstractCmd
   exec::Vector{String}
   ignorestatus::Bool
   flags::UInt32 # libuv process flags
   env::Union{Array{String},Nothing}
   dir::String
   Cmd(exec::Vector{String}) =
       new(exec, false, 0x00, nothing, "")
...
источник

MV

Mitya Volodin in Язык программирования Julia / Julia programming language
Борис Бакулин
я же тоже самое делал
не совсем, я проставил их дважды ))
источник

MV

Mitya Volodin in Язык программирования Julia / Julia programming language
точнее снаружи обернул
источник

ББ

Борис Бакулин... in Язык программирования Julia / Julia programming language
понял , спасибо ))
источник
2020 September 17

RS

Roman Samarev in Язык программирования Julia / Julia programming language
https://discourse.julialang.org/t/comonicon-jl-fast-simple-and-light-weight-cli-generator/43744/4

Новый пакет для разбора аргументов командной строки с малым временем запуска
источник

ЕП

Евгений Погребняк... in Язык программирования Julia / Julia programming language
@main это из пакета экспортируется?
источник

RS

Roman Samarev in Язык программирования Julia / Julia programming language
Евгений Погребняк
@main это из пакета экспортируется?
Из их пакета
источник

RS

Roman Samarev in Язык программирования Julia / Julia programming language
источник

VG

Viktor G. in Язык программирования Julia / Julia programming language
какой у Джулии стандартный TOML парсер?
источник

VG

Viktor G. in Язык программирования Julia / Julia programming language
что-то add TOML не находит пакет
источник

АО

Андрей Оськин... in Язык программирования Julia / Julia programming language
using Pkg

Pkg.TOML
источник

АО

Андрей Оськин... in Язык программирования Julia / Julia programming language
Он как внутренний модуль в Pkg идёт.
источник

АО

Андрей Оськин... in Язык программирования Julia / Julia programming language
Можно конечно и руками поставить, через add https://github.com/JuliaLang/TOML.jl.git
источник

VG

Viktor G. in Язык программирования Julia / Julia programming language
Есть ли какая-то теория для того, как описывать:
1) группы несовместных событий (не могут встречаться одновременно)
2) группы независимых событий (комбинации)
В применении к категориальным признакам объектов, где событие = признак?

1) Несовместная группа признаков может принимать только одно значение из возможных.
Примеры несовместных признаков:

а) Бинарные:
- видимый: [да, нет],
- нажат: [да, нет],
- перемещается: [да, нет]
б) Многозначные (с более чем двумя значениями):
- перемещается: [да, нет, неизвестно]
- направление: [вверх, вниз, вправо, влево]

2) Группа независимых признаков может принимать любую комбинацию значений входящих в него признаков.
Примеры комбинаций признаков:

а) Группа состоит только из (групп?) бинарных признаков
- состояние: [видимый: [да, нет], нажат: [да, нет], перемещается: [да, нет]]
б) Группа состоит как из (групп?) бинарных, так и из многозначных признаков:
- движение: [перемещается: [да, нет], направление: [вверх, вниз, вправо, влево]]
источник

VG

Viktor G. in Язык программирования Julia / Julia programming language
Хочется найти форматы для описания кодировок этих признаков (формат метаданных).
источник

VG

Viktor G. in Язык программирования Julia / Julia programming language
Пытался сделать такую штуку для кодирования битовыми масками: https://github.com/sairus7/try_bitcategories.jl/blob/master/test_features.jl
источник

АО

Андрей Оськин... in Язык программирования Julia / Julia programming language
А что должно быть с этими группами? Ну, что прячется за их описанием?

Просто например с точки зрения задания всех возможных элементов, "группы несовместных событий" - это просто вектора/кортежи, а "группы независимых событий" - это декартово произведение групп несовместных событий.
источник

АО

Андрей Оськин... in Язык программирования Julia / Julia programming language
С точки зрения задания данных yaml с якорями может подойти.
источник